Things to do near Kauai beach

Named as the ‘Garden Island,’ Kauai beach offers everything an adventure-lover can want. From snorkeling to surfing to spotting 100-year-old sea turtles and seals on the beach on Poipu Beach, all is possible. Poipu Beach is a tourist-friendly beach, facilitated with washrooms, lifeguards, and a children’s zone. Do not miss to pack some snacks and have a picnic or a cookout on the beach.

But if you are a peace-lover, visit Kiahuna Beach and take a relaxing stroll on the beach’s soft white sands. It is linked to Poipu Beach but is an uncrowded area. You can also stroll along the fascinating glass beach, filled with smooth and colorful glass pebbles.

Besides enjoying the beach activities, you and your group of travelers can also hike in the Waimea Canyon and enjoy the scenic scenery of the mesmerizing 800 feet long waterfall. Try planning your hiking trip 2-3 hours before dusk so you can watch the golden sunset into the mountains.

If you are vacationing in Hawaii, experiencing the Napali Coastline is a must. You can tour the coastline on a helicopter, ride around it on a boat, or hike it. Helicopter rides promise to offer the best top view. However, it can cost over, and if the clouds are thick, it is not the best choice. Sailing to see the gigantic cliffs of Napali Coastline is a superb choice as it offers a relaxing and enjoyable trip along with whales spotting and snorkeling opportunities. Hiking might be a little tiring, but it is the cheapest and the most thrilling option. Follow the Pihea Trail to get the best scenery of Napali Coastline. Hiking addicts can also hike up the Mahaulepu Heritage Trail and the Kokee State Park.

Take your loved one to a romantic drive along the Waimea Canyon. Do not forget to make a quick visit to the Spouting Horn Blowhole to witness water blow out of rocks. Finally, do not forget to get souvenirs for your friends and family back home from Warehouse 3540, an artistic store that sells locally manufactured jewelry and clothes.

Snorkeling in Kuaui

Kee Beach in northern Kauai is best for snorkeling during the summer. Explore different kinds of fishes and vibrant corals in this region. Ensure that snorkel along the left side of the rocks surrounding NaPali as currents there is usually high. Haena Beach Park has more suitable seasons for snorkeling. Spot turtles, yellow tang, jellyfish, parrotfish, and many other beautiful sea lives while snorkeling. Lydgate Beach Park has a snorkeling area protected from the sea. There you can snorkel without worrying about rip currents.

Playgrounds, picnics restroom facilities are also available for you to have a whole day of fun. Lifeguards are present on most of Kauai’s beaches, so do not forget to talk to them before diving into the sea.

Best beaches near Kauai

Being the oldest island of its kind, Kauai boasts rich layers of the forest, sharp cliffs, and picturesque beaches. Distinguished for its fine sand, magnificent mountains, and stunning riverscape and landscape, Hanalei Beach is highly favored by tourists. If you are an amateur surfer, surf along the pier where waves are calmer, and if you are an experienced surfer, surf along the reef. Tourists can also go scuba diving and explore two vibrant coral reefs.

Stationed in the middle of NaPali and Limahuli, Kee Beach offers breathtaking scenery of blue waters, beige sand, and green mountains. As the shooting location for many famous Hollywood movies, Kee Beach is immensely popular among tourists. Hiking, Kayaking, and chilling at the beach are the top activities. Get there early in the morning to find easy parking and enjoy some rush-free time.

Best known for beach walks, boogie boarding, and swimming, the northern section of Kealia Beach consists of calm blue waters and soft sand. If you are visiting in winter, do not miss the opportunity to watch majestic whales rising through the waters.

Poipu Beach in southern Kauai is famous among families with children, mainly for its children’s dedicated section. It is the ultimate site for picnics, birthdays, beach games, and family fun.
